Output 646449fa577c8b94707bf0eb83b3db23eb0e449bb4c0b93349a7e36e94de1776:0

value
6473748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f756d9081110fd84204efcdd41fe35cbfea1fa OP_EQUAL
address
3KeUfaHyJwXnFtrxuVv49xKYFG951DQkoX
transaction
646449fa577c8b94707bf0eb83b3db23eb0e449bb4c0b93349a7e36e94de1776
confirmations
366310
spent
true